
Over a three-month period, contributed to the UAVGCSTeam/GCS repository by building a scalable drone data management backend and a refreshed Drone Management UI. Leveraging C++, Qt, and QML, established a persistent data model with CRUD operations, integrated database initialization at startup, and ensured seamless UI-backend interaction. Enhanced data integrity by enforcing unique drone names and supporting multi-drone management, while improving operator workflows through UI updates and robust window management. Refactored the drone management stack for maintainability and introduced testing utilities to streamline development. The work laid a solid foundation for analytics, scalable testing, and future enhancements in drone operations.
